Earthquake Aftershocks Continue in Mato Grosso do Sul, Brazil

Edited by: Anna 🌎 Krasko

Following an earthquake in Sonora, Mato Grosso do Sul, Brazil, on Tuesday, at least 16 aftershocks have been recorded. The aftershocks, registered by the Brazilian Seismographic Network (RSBR), are common after a primary seismic event.

These secondary tremors ranged in magnitude from 1.0 to 2.1. The most recent aftershock was recorded at 9:20 AM on Tuesday.

Mato Grosso do Sul has experienced nine seismic events in 2024, ranging from 1.6 to 3.5 in magnitude. The main earthquake occurred 100 kilometers from Sonora.
